Bangkok Office Market Summary: Q4 2024
Economic Context
The Thai economy is projected to grow by 2.7% in 2024 and 2.9% in 2025. The Business Sentiment Index (BSI) remained on an upward trajectory, supported by tourism and service sector recovery, despite a slight decline in Q4 2024 due to heightened global and domestic uncertainty, including U.S. policies affecting trade and growth.
Supply Analysis
Bangkok's office market maintained a stable total supply of 6.31 million sq m in Q4 2024, with no additions or withdrawals quarter-on-quarter. Over 2024, supply increased by 235,000 sq m. The future supply pipeline stands at 1.0 million sq m, with an anticipated high of 540,000 sq m in 2025.
Demand Analysis
Leasing activity remained strong, with net absorption of 48,000 sq m, maintaining occupied space at 4.86 million sq m. Green buildings attracted significant demand, with a net absorption of 50,000 sq m compared to a marginal decline in non-green buildings. Both CBD and non-CBD areas reported positive absorption.
Market Dynamics
The overall occupancy rate rose to 77%, driven by gains across all building grades, with Grade A (76%) showing the strongest rebound due to preference for quality spaces. Average asking rents held steady at THB 842/sq m/month overall, with Grade A reaching a new high of THB 1,246/sq m/month. CBD and non-CBD submarkets showed modest rental and occupancy increases.
Outlook
The market faces supply pressures in 2025 with a projected influx. Landlords must strategically position assets, particularly Grade A properties, which benefit from tenant demand for high-quality, amenity-rich environments. A key trend is the return to traditional office setups amid evolving workplace preferences.
